Text

(1)ESTABLISHMENT; PURPOSE. — The Open Door Grant Program is established and shall be administered by participating institutions in accordance with rules of the State Board of Education. The program is created to incentivize current and future workers to enroll in career and technical education that leads to a credential, certificate, or degree.
(2)ELIGIBILITY. — In order to be eligible for the program, a student must:
(a)Meet the requirements under s. 1009.40(1)(a)2. and 3.;
